Iloilo town hall locked down

THE San Joaquin Municipal Hall in Iloilo was placed on a lockdown starting Thursday after 18 of its employees tested positive for coronavirus disease-19.

The local government unit said the temporary closure of the town hall was to pave the way for disinfection.

The building will be opened on September 1.

To ensure the continuous public service, an Operation Center was set up in front of the municipal hall to serve residents and those with official transactions.

Reports said four of the employees on Monday initially tested positive for the dreaded virus.

A swab test was immediately made on people whom the four had got in close contact with.

The result of the swab test was released last Thursday, showing14 other employees also tested positive for COVID-19. They are asymptomatic.

According to the Iloilo Provincial Health Office, San Joaquin has 64 COVID-19 cases.
